1.1.0 GENERAL INTRODUCTION
Medical establishments like hospitals, rehabilitation
centers, health-saloons etc. are seen as figures of hope when struck with
illness. Just like other organizations, medical establishments are also
well-organized, following rigid and complex processes. In recent years, records
have shown an increase in inaccuracy and imprecision in medical diagnosis as
most patient who are unable to a clinic for proper diagnosis end up treating
sickness inappropriately. The advent of computer and internet has made it
possible for millions to access proper medical diagnosis and are administer
correct treatment procedures. Today, several algorithm, models and technologies
are put in place to ensure accurate and precise diagnosis on patient which in turns
has reduce the rate of mortality in the country and world at large. One of such
technologies is fuzzy logics
Online Medical Diagnosis Software(OMDS) automates the whole
process of patience diagnosis with accurate and precise result using a well
detail and proven algorithm to achieve it desire output, one of such algorithm
is fuzzy logic a branch of artificial intelligent. Using the software will
remove all such complexities as it helps you retrieve your information
accurately.

1.3.0 PROBLEM DEFINITION
This research work OMDS was undertaken to uncover some of the
problems that characterized the traditional method of medical diagnostic which
has taken many lives. Here patient take drugs base on ancient myth, past
experience and drugs availability not knowing that same symptom can cut across
several illnesses and thereby engaging in drugs abuse.The propose OMDS is meant
to diagnose various diseases in an expert system such as Malaria, Typhoid,
Cholera, Ebola etc. Fuzzy logic is chosen as the artificial intelligence tool
employed in the proposed system because it is one of the most efficient
qualitative computation methods

1.7.0 SCOPE AND LIMITATION OF STUDY
This research work is to develop a system capable of
diagnosing only disease and their symptoms stated below.
Malaria:
Symptoms of malaria
• Fever
• Headache
• Weakness
• Myalgia or Muscle pain
• Arthralgia or Joint Pain
• Anorexia or Lack of appetite
• Diarrhea
• nausea and vomiting
• abdominal pain
• Chills or Cold
Cholera
Symptoms:
• watery diarrhea
• volume depletion or dehydration
• vomiting
• abdominal pain or stomach pain
• lethargy or Laziness or Fatigue
Typhoid
Symptoms:
• high fever
• dull frontal headache
• abdominal pain
• anorexia: eating disorder and weight loss
• constipation
• cough
• diarrhea
• malaise or fatigue
• chills
Yellow Fever symptoms:
• fever
• conjunctiva injection or Red eyes
• relative bradycardia or Slow heart beat
• Jaundice or yellowish Skin
• hemorrhagic diathesis or Bleeding
• hypotension or Low blood Pressure
• hypotension
• lethargy or Laziness or Fatigue
• vomiting
Ebola
Symptoms of Ebola include:
• Fever
• Severe headache
• Muscle pain
• Weakness
• Fatigue
• Diarrhea
• Vomiting
• Abdominal (stomach) pain
• Unexplained hemorrhage (bleeding or bruising)
Tuberculosis
Signs and symptoms of active TB include:
• Coughing that lasts three or more weeks.
• Coughing up blood.
• Chest pain, or pain with breathing or coughing.
• Unintentional weight loss.
• Fatigue.
• Fever.
• Night sweats.
• Chills.
